NDDB to Strengthen Arunachal Dairy Sector with Federations

Itanagar, Jul 3 (PTI): The National Dairy Development Board (NDDB) is set to boost the dairy sector in Arunachal Pradesh by establishing 'Milk Unions' and 'Milk Federations', according to an official statement.

In an ambitious endeavor, five milk unions will be formed based on the state's five river basins, with the project kicking off in Lohit, Namsai, and Lower Dibang Valley districts of the Lohit River basin, revealed S Roy, NDDB's Kolkata regional head, during a training session for enumerators and supervisors in Namsai's Chowkham circle on Wednesday.

Efforts are underway to establish similar milk unions in the Siang, Subansiri, Kameng, and Tirap basins. Ultimately, these unions will coalesce into a state-level 'milk federation', promising new opportunities in the dairy and allied sectors.

D Longri, director of the State Animal Husbandry, Veterinary, and Dairy Development department, underscored the importance of completing the survey work promptly, setting a deadline of July 31, 2025, for the Lohit basin survey.

Longri expressed concerns that several districts, despite their significant dairy potential, have lagged in establishing dairy cooperative societies.

This delay is impeding Arunachal's progress under the White Revolution 2.0, he noted, urging a concerted focus on initiating a milk union encompassing Lohit, Namsai, and Lower Dibang Valley as a model for others. He instructed district veterinary officers to prioritize the survey to ensure its timely completion.
